Output 00ae24ed5cf9a98df76d7867f21bccdd31189dca19a520f0a7ea8dcf538816ff:3

value
673033
script pubkey
OP_0 OP_PUSHBYTES_20 8faef364fa538c3589d7437489a44ec234df649b
address
bc1q37h0xe862wxrtzwhgd6gnfzwcg6d7eymw84wdy
transaction
00ae24ed5cf9a98df76d7867f21bccdd31189dca19a520f0a7ea8dcf538816ff
spent
true